Various Kinds of Pharmacy Technician Schools in Trafalgar IN
In the US and Canada, some PT tasks do not require any certification or schooling although the majority of do. Those who have education and certification are absolutely more effective for positions, however, making schooling something that any person looking at a profession as a PT should consider extremely seriously.
In all likelihood, even more Trafalgar IN tasks will move toward needing accreditation as well, so avoiding the education could decrease task hire and development opportunity.
Pharmacy Technician education is offered in programs that last anywhere from 6 months to 2 years or even more, relying on the depth of training.
Like many other medical training and technical programs in Trafalgar IN, the much shorter programs give a basic, essential review of what to anticipate on the job and general education connecting to fundamental pharmacology, pharmacology law, pharmacology records, inventory, identifying, purchasing and numerous other appropriate topics to working in a retail pharmacy environment.
Courses and diploma programs
Students that go to the shorter programs generally earn a Pharmacy Technician Certificate for conclusion of the program, but have actually no real authorized certifications.
Longer courses provided by schools in Trafalgar INinclude specialized diploma programs and Associates Degree courses that last between about 12 months to 24 months.
Diploma programs are great for students who currently have some healthcare service experience and wish to move into a position as a PT, as well as those getting in the field new.
Research study generally consists of all that is discussed above, plus pharmacology in more detail, dosage estimation, blending medicines and others, and usually includes an externship to prepare students to take the certification exam. Students completing a diploma course and passing their certification test will make the title of Certified Pharmacy Technician or CPhT.
Associates in Health Sciences with a PT specialized takes two years and is suggested for any specific if there is an interest in both acquiring a college degree, and having the ability to advance the fastest in their profession.
Courses of study are far more in depth and include extra medical patients. Externships are a required part of the curriculum, as is passing the accreditation exam. Those with their CPhT and an AS degree stand the best opportunity of being hired in non-retail pharmacy technician positions, and starting at the highest salaries.
Accredited employment program
In the UK and lots of other countries a pharmacy technician is needed to complete both a recognized employment program in pharmacy services and a pharmaceutical science program, and have to be registered with numerous UK healthcare companies.
Courses of study consist of that which is pointed out above, as well as medicines management for patients and training in running and helping in healthcare facility centers and more.
Please note however, in the UK there is a distinction between a pharmacy technician and a pharmacy dispenser, with the former having more trade and instructional requirements.

Work After Attending PT Schools
There are actually numerous more employment opportunities for PTs than many people assume. While most of tasks are in retail pharmacy positions there are much more customized career alternatives for pharmacy techs with the right training.
Healthcare facilities, medicine manufacturing and packing business, medicine compounding pharmacies, nursing houses, psychiatric centers and any kind of clinical center that either fills medicine prescribeds or dispenses medications directly to clients use pharmacy professionals.
These positions can be really rewarding, and tend to pay more too. Certain certified technicians also have the ability to counsel consumers and patients on the use of their medications, in addition to response medicine concerns.
